I changed my TV tuner and have now ruined my car?

Hi all,

My TV tuner was not working, Monday night removed the old TV tuner... Confirmed water had damaged the old tuner (Digital 2010 3.6td VCool

Left the tuner out whilst my new one arrived today - so unable to use my screen whilst the tuner was out.

New one came today, fit it and unable to click aux, TV, radio or anything... No problem, thought it was a dodgy tuner, put the old one back in... Same symptoms unable to access aux, cd player or radio (does not let me chose it on the touch screen, all I get in a beep when trying to select DAB for example) tried to make a call from my phone... Rings but no volume in the car at all. Other person answers can't hear hear them...

Plug the new TV tuner in, try make a call. Can't hear the other person... Been at it almost an hour now no sound and screen does not let me select any of the sources

I have not bolted any of the bolts back, the unit is just in there free standing whilst I try figure this out. Any idea what I've done?

The fibre-optic cable is flashing red and literally all I did was remove it on Monday and installed the new one today... Now both units are not working, no sound nor can I click anywhere?

Hi, sounds like when it's booting up it's not seeing the other devices on the MOST loop.

It could be the systems got itself tied up in a knot. When stuff like this happens to me, switch it all off, lock the car up with the key fob, give it 30 secs and unlock it, sometimes that resets everything.

If that fails disconnect the battery negative, go have a cup of tea, come back 10 mins later and reconnect the battery. I'm always surprised that this actually works in 50% of cases so worth a try.

Beyond that I'd start looking at fuses and power resets of each device in turn, it doesn't sound like a faulty unit.
